Located on the iconic Las Vegas Strip, Four Seasons Hotel Las Vegas offers a unique, non-gaming oasis in one of the most vibrant entertainment capitals of the world. Adjacent to the Mandalay Bay Resort & Casino, it stands out as one of the few non-gaming and non-smoking hotels on the Strip, providing guests with a serene and tranquil environment amidst the city's bustling energy. This Five Diamond property features a Forbes Five-Star Spa and blends the best of both worlds—resort-like relaxation paired with proximity to Las Vegas' nightlife and entertainment. Guests can also explore nearby natural attractions such as the Grand Canyon and Red Rock National Conservation Area, adding to the hotel's appeal as a prime destination.

The Service Bartender role at Four Seasons Las Vegas is pivotal in maintaining the high standards of luxury hospitality the brand is known for. This position is responsible for the knowledge, preparation, and presentation of wines, mixed drinks, and spirits to meet guest preferences precisely and efficiently. The role demands a passion for luxury service, an understanding of fine beverages, and the ability to provide attentive and personalized guest interactions. Maintaining accurate inventory records of all bar items is essential to ensure operational efficiency and service excellence.

Ideal candidates will bring previous bartending experience within a luxury environment, strong organizational skills to thrive in a fast-paced setting, and excellent communication abilities to engage with guests and team members effectively. Physical stamina including the ability to lift up to 40lbs is necessary due to the demands of the job. This position works part-time primarily on Mondays and Tuesdays, covering vacations and callouts, providing flexibility and opportunities to join a respected global brand known for its employee development and comprehensive benefits.
